The Legendary Strike (1978), also released as A Fist Too Fast, Iron Maiden, Lang Tzu Yi Chao (浪子一招), Shaolin World, and Shaolin Warriors, is a Hong Kong and Taiwanese martial arts adventure directed by Huang Feng. Starring Angela Mao, Chen Sing, Chu Kong, Carter Wong, Kam Kong, Lung Chan, and featuring stunt work by Mars, the film combines fast-paced kung fu, swordplay, political intrigue, and a relentless hunt for one of the most valuable treasures in the martial arts world. STORY OVERVIEW
During the final years of the Ching Dynasty, rival factions race to possess the legendary Buddha's Relic, a priceless treasure hidden inside the body of a murdered courier. Ming loyalists, corrupt nobles, Shaolin monks, Japanese agents, and Korean warriors all pursue the relic across dangerous countryside filled with deception and deadly ambushes. As alliances constantly shift, skilled fighter Chin Lun joins the struggle, leading to fierce confrontations that build toward an unforgettable climax without revealing the film's ending.

HISTORICAL SIGNIFICANCE
Released in 1978, The Legendary Strike was produced outside the major Shaw Brothers and Golden Harvest studio systems during a period when independent martial arts productions were flourishing. Directed by Huang Feng, the film reflects the international character of late-1970s Hong Kong action cinema by bringing Chinese, Korean, and Japanese characters into one fast-moving martial arts adventure.

Verified AKAs:
- The Legendary Strike – International English title
- A Fist Too Fast – English release title
- Iron Maiden – Alternate English title
- Lang Tzu Yi Chao – Romanized original title
- 浪子一招 – Original Chinese title
- Shaolin World – Alternate international title
- Shaolin Warriors – Alternate export title
- Director: Huang Feng
- Producer: Chu Sheng-Hsi, Liu En-Chai
- Writer: Ku Lung (Gu Long)
- Music: Frankie Chan
- Cinematography: Li Yu-Tang
- Editor: Peter Cheung
- Studios: Chia Fu Film Company, Graphic Films (H.K.) Ltd.
- Starring: Angela Mao, Chen Sing, Chu Kong, Carter Wong, Kam Kong, Lung Chan, Casanova Wong, Mars
- Country: Hong Kong, Taiwan
- Genre: Martial Arts, Kung Fu, Action, Adventure
- Martial Arts Focus: Traditional Kung Fu, Swordplay, Shaolin Martial Arts
